Frequently Asked Questions:
---------------------------

Q: Help! There's so many files here, which one do I download?
A:
The only essential file to get the theme is Royale Remixed Theme v1.46 Final windows installer. After this has been installed, you can choose to download and install any of the following patches under 'For Royale Noir colour scheme only'. Installing any one of the patch will overwrite any previously installed patch, so it's a mutually exclusive scenario.

Q: After installing the theme, my desktop only display the classic windows?
A:
Because this is not an official desktop theme made by Microsoft, a modified uxtheme.dll system file is needed to use this theme. Simply follow the link provided (or here) to download the Uxtheme Multi-Patcher 5.0 or Universal Theme Patcher 2.1 (here), run it and follow the instructions to guide you through the process.

Q: I get an error message while installing Uxtheme Multi-patcher saying Windows NT setup files are detected in c:\windows\i386?
A:
There are 2 reasons for this, the first, you didn't read the instruction carefully telling you not to insert your windows CD when prompted. The second, your OEM system comes with system files backed up in windows\i386 folder. This folder acts as the windows CD when system files need to be copied over, it is non-essential for the operation of the system. Renaming it or moving it someplace else ie burning onto a CD etc, should enable you to patch your uxtheme.dll.

Q: I can't patch uxtheme using the patchers?
A:
If none of the patchers work for you, then you have to replace uxtheme.dll manually. Refer to this link for instructions and downloads of various uxtheme.dll for your windows XP version.

Q: I can't install the theme on my x64 machine?
A:
There are 2 installers provided, one for 32bit machines and another for x64. Download the one labelled '(x64 Installer)'.

Q: I've patched my uxtheme.dll using the Multi-patcher on my x64 machine but it still displays the windows classic desktop?
A:
If you are running Windows XP x64, you need to patch 2 uxtheme.dll. Refer to the instructions in this post.

Q: I've installed the theme but I get an error message telling me my themes service is not running?
A:
You need to enable the themes service, note that Windows Server 2003 has the themes service turned off by default. Follow the same instructions for both Windows XP and Server 2003 in the link here.
